JOINT RESOLUTION OF THE BOARD OF SUPERVISORS OF THE COUNTY OF LOS ANGELES
ACTING IN BEHALF OF
Los Angeles County General Fund
Los Angeles County Library
Los Angeles County Flood Control
Los Angeles County Fire Protection District
Los Angeles County Fire - FF W
THE BOARD OF DIRECTORS OF COUNTY SANITATION DISTRICT NO. 26 OF THE COUNTY OF
LOS ANGELES, AND THE GOVERNING BODIES OF
City of Santa Clarita
Castaic Lake Water Agency
Greater Los Angeles County Vector Control District
APPROVING AND ACCEPTING NEGOTIATED EXCHANGE OF PROPERTY TAX REVENUES
RESULTING FROM ANNEXATION TO COUNTY SANITATION DISTRICT NO. 26.
"ANNEXATION NO. 290"
WHEREAS, pursuant to Section 99 and 99.1 of the Revenue and Taxation Code, prior to the effective
date of any jurisdictional change which will result in a special district providing a new service, the governing
bodies of all local agencies that receive an apportionment of the property tax from the area must determine the
amount of property tax revenues from the annual tax increment to be exchanged between the affected agencies
and approve and accept the negotiated exchange of property tax revenues by resolution, and
WHEREAS, the governing bodies of the agencies signatory hereto have made determinations of the
amount of property tax revenues from the annual tax increments to be exchanged as a result of the annexation
to County Sanitation District No. 26 entitled Annexation No. 290.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ED AS FOLLOWS
1. The negotiated exchange of property tax revenues resulting from the annexation of territory to
County Sanitation District No. 26 in the annexation entitled Annexation No. 290 is approved and accepted.
2. For each fiscal year commencing on and after July 1, 1996 or after the effective date of this
jurisdictional change, whichever is later, the County Auditor shall transfer to County Sanitation District No. 26
a total of 1.1074 percent of the Annual Tax Increment attributable to the land area encompassed within
Annexation No. 290.
Said percentage has been determined on the basis of the following contributions.
AGENCY PERCENT
Los Angeles County General Fund
0.5014
Los Angeles County Library
0.0414
Los Angeles County Flood Control
0.0194
Los Angeles County Fire Protection District
0.2913
Los Angeles County Fire - FFW
0.0247
City of Santa Clarita
0.1120
Castaic Lake Water Agency
0.1166
Greater Los Angeles County Vector Control District
0.0006
TOTAL 1.1074
3. No additional transfer of property tax revenues shall be made from any other taxing agencies
to County Sanitation District No. 26 as a result of annexation entitled Annexation No. 290.
4. No transfer of property tax revenues from properties within a community redevelopment project
shall be made during the period that the entire tax increment is legally committed for repayment of the
redevelopment project costs.
5. If at any time after the effective date of this resolution, the calculations used herein to determine
initial property tax transfers or the data used to perforin those calculations are found to be incorrect thus
producing an improper or inaccurate property tax transfer, the property tax transfer shall be recalculated and the
corrected transfer shall be implemented for the next fiscal year, and any amounts of property tax received in
excess of that which is proper shall be refunded to the appropriate agency.
The foregoing resolution was adopted by the Board of Supervisors of the County of Los Angeles, the
Board of Directors of County Sanitation District No. 26 and the governing bodies of City of Santa Clarita,
Castaic Lake Water Agency, and Greater Los Angeles County Vector Control District, signatory hereto.
